
问题简述:很多用户发现用TP钱包(或类似去中心化钱包)转账时无法“一键把余额转空”,常见表现包括转账失败、剩余少量代币无法转出或提示手续费不足。造成这种现象并非简单bug,而是多个层面因素交织的结果。以下从全球科技支付平台、账户余额与手续费、全球化技术变革、多链平台特性、未来科技发展及数字金融革命六个方面做全面探讨并给出应对建议。
1. 全球科技支付平台的设计与限制
去中心化钱包在设计上需兼顾安全与用户体验。作为连接多种区块链与DApp的“中枢”,钱包需保留原生链的燃料(如ETH、BNB等)以支付矿工费。许多钱包不会自动在转账时“自动卖出”代币并支付手续费,因为这涉及签名、合约授权及用户风险承受问题。支付平台对交易失败的防护逻辑,通常会拒绝把所有可用余额用于普通代币转账以避免因手续费不足而使交易陷入失败或卡死。
2. 账户余额与燃料代币(Gas)机制
区块链的交易需要原生链代币作为gas。如果你的钱包里只有某种代币而没有足够的原生燃料,便无法把代币全部转出——即使代币价值远高于手续费,也无法直接用代币自动抵扣(除非使用特定服务或合约)。此外,智能合约代币可能会收取转账税(transfer tax)、最小转账额或锁定期,导致“剩余少量”无法转出。
3. 全球化技术变革对用户行为的影响
随着全球支付平台的互联,用户期待跨链、跨币种的便捷操作。但现有基础设施仍处于分散阶段:不同链的经济模型、手续费波动、合约标准不一,使得“一次转空”成为复杂操作。某些服务为保证交易成功,会主动保留一小笔用于应急或回滚处理。
4. 多链平台的复杂性与跨链费用
多链钱包需管理多个地址与多种原生代币。跨链桥、桥接手续费、跨链延迟及滑点,都可能让用户无法在单一操作中把所有资产转移完毕。某些代币部署在多条链上,实际可用余额分散在不同网络,用户需要分别清算。
5. 未来科技发展可能带来的改变
未来的解决方向包括:原生代币与代币化手续费的自动兑换(智能合约在转账时自动swap部分代币支付gas)、更智能的钱包UX(在用户授权下自动处理燃料不足)、以及更高效的Layer2与跨链协议降低手续费并简化跨链转账流程。同时,标准化合约模板可能减少transfer tax与最小转账限制。

6. 数字金融革命与合规安全考量
随着数字金融制度化,监管与合规也会影响转账自由度。例如反洗钱、交易追踪以及托管服务可能对一次性大额或“扫空”操作设置限制。钱包与支付平台需在便捷与合规之间取得平衡。
建议与操作技巧:
- 转账前确保有足够的原生链燃料(少量ETH/BNB等)。
- 若要“清空”代币,先将少量代币换为原生代币以支付gas(使用DEX或快捷兑换)。
- 注意代币合约是否有转账税、最小额度或锁仓条款,查看代币合约或社区说明。
- 对于分布在多链的资产,逐链操作或使用可靠的跨链服务。
- 若遇异常,可导出交易记录或联系钱包客服,避免盲目多次尝试造成更高手续费或失败。
结论:TP钱包无法一次转完余额通常是多种技术与生态因素共同作用的结果,包括燃料代币需求、智能合约限制、多链复杂性和合规安全考虑。随着技术进步和标准化推进,未来钱包将更智能、更自动化,但当前用户仍需理解链上规则并采取相应操作以顺利转账。
评论
AlexChen
讲得很全面,我之前因为没留ETH导致几次转账失败,原来是这个原因。
小雨
建议里提到的先换少量代币为gas很实用,解决了我的尴尬问题。
CryptoTiger
多链确实麻烦,期待更好的跨链桥和Layer2解决方案。
李想
关于合约税和最小转账额能否举个具体代币的例子?对新手会更友好。
Wang_88
文章提醒了合规因素,这一点常被忽视,尤其是大额转移时需注意监管风险。